Technical Information:
Choose from our range of FDDI (MIC) Fiber optic cables. All our cables are made here in Australia and guaranteed to perform. All Fiber cable assemblies manufactured comply to EIA/TIA standards.


Application:
► CATV & CCTV;
► Fiber Optic Telecommunications;
► LAN (Local Area Network);
► FTTH (Fiber To the Home);
► High speed transmission Systems.


Features:
► Low Insertion Loss;
► Good Repeatability;
► Good Changeability;
► Good Temperature Stabilization.
